Ashton Kutcher is speaking out again following him and his wife Mila Kunis‘ letters of support for convicted rapist Danny Masterson.

A screenshot of a text Ashton sent to his mailing list has surfaced on Twitter, and the 45-year-old actor is attempting to explain his decision to vouch for Danny. They all starred on That ’70s Show together.

The message reads: “A friend said something me today: We have one heart we can fill in with hatred or love. I chose love.”

The message comes days after news broke that Ashton and Mila had written letters of support for Danny prior to his sentencing for his conviction on two counts of forcible rape earlier this year.

The couple received tons of backlash from the public, and Ashton and Mila released a video in response.

Ashton Kutcher and Mila Kunis‘ support of Danny Masterson drew criticism from many, including actress Christina Ricci, who recently spoke out about the controversy.
